Digital Theka is a leading seo company in delhi with a proven track record of success. We have helped businesses of all sizes to improve their online visibility and generate more leads and sales.
Like
Comment
Share
Digital Theka is a leading seo company in delhi with a proven track record of success. We have helped businesses of all sizes to improve their online visibility and generate more leads and sales.